For Starters, Keds Designer Sneakers

Keds sneakers? Yes, custom built keds sneakers through Ked's Collectives, a collaboration between Keds and Zazzle online. It's an inexpensive way to design and create a prototypes, such as you see here. Neos, which you see here, are one of my more successful shoe designs. The only problem, at $65, they are ridiculously expensive for a consumer shoe of the basic Keds sneaker. I would love to sell these but it seems impossible to make a profit unless I have them mass produced. Unfortunately, I don't want to get into the shoe sales business. Selling my designs to a shoe manufacturer is my only thought but is it really possible?
